I have a 18-55 MM F/3.5-5.6 VR lens and 2.0X telephoto lens.
But some of my friends suggested that 18-105 mm (Kit Lens is much useful than this.)
can 18-55 MM lens + 2.0x photo lens can give the same result of 18-105 mm lens.
Based on the discussion, I am planning to buy the new 18-105 lens for my Nikon D90.
When you use a doubler (2x added lens) you double the lens length, and reduce lens' apertures by half, which means your zoom lens will have maximum aperture of f/7.
I agree with Nikonian - all else being equal, the 18-105 is better than the 2x approach. And at the 55mm end, the widest aperture drops to f/11.
Is the teleconverter a Nikon model? I was under the impression that the Nikon TCs will not physically mount to the kit lenses because of the two-stop impairment.
